Role : Working as part of the Payroll team, the Benefits Administrator will be responsible for managing and administering employee benefits programs.
This role requires a strong understanding of benefits administration, excellent organizational skills, and the ability to work efficiently in a dynamic environment.
Responsibilities :
- Perform full-cycle payroll for union / nonunion employees including processing new hires, terminations, rate changes, direct deposits, ROE’s, pension and T-4’s.
- Coordinate payroll activities to ensure all pay data is complied, processed and reconciled in an accurate and timely manner to meet all payroll deadlines.
- Reconciliation of all statutory requirements, deductions and other payroll related accounts.
- Calculate, deduct, reconcile and remit amounts ordered to be withheld through garnishment, third party demand, or family support deduction orders.
- Execute payroll and generate payroll runs, and create associated journal entries.
- Respond to payroll-related inquiries from employees and managers in a timely and efficient manner.
- Assisting with Group Benefits, Pension, and RRSP / Cross-train with other Payroll Administrators on administering benefits such as enrollment, termination of benefit, preparing benefit package, cost allocation, and related items.
- Maintain up to date and accurate record of accumulated hours and seniority list.
- Review and apply wage increases for part time and relief employees.
- Participate in regular payroll audits to guarantee accuracy of data and ensure all payroll processes and procedures are adhered to.
- Prepare reports for various departments.
- Updating employee contract package and COLA calculations.
- Covering vacations & Cross training for various pay groups.
- Other duties and projects as required, as well as sorting and filing documents.
